noc大赛淄博主要什么编程

不及物动词 其他 23

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    NOC(网络技术运维大赛)是一项面向大学生的网络技术比赛,旨在培养和选拔优秀的网络运维人才。在淄博地区,NOC大赛主要涉及以下几个方面的编程技术:

    1. 网络编程:参赛选手需要掌握网络编程技术,包括socket编程、TCP/IP协议、网络通信等。他们需要通过编写代码实现网络通信功能,如网络传输文件、实现远程控制等。

    2. 网络安全编程:网络安全是NOC大赛的重要内容之一,选手需要具备一定的网络安全知识和编程技术。他们需要能够编写代码实现网络漏洞的利用与修复,如SQL注入、XSS攻击、CSRF攻击等。同时,他们还需要了解网络防御技术,如防火墙、入侵检测系统等。

    3. 自动化运维编程:NOC大赛注重培养网络运维人才,选手需要具备自动化运维的编程技术。他们需要能够编写脚本或程序实现网络设备的自动化配置与管理,如自动备份网络设备、自动监控网络状态等。

    4. 数据分析与算法编程:NOC大赛还包括一些数据分析和算法编程的内容。选手需要能够处理并分析大量的网络数据,如网络流量数据、日志数据等。他们需要具备一定的数据分析和算法编程能力,如使用Python、R等编程语言进行数据处理和分析。

    总之,参加NOC大赛的选手需要具备网络编程、网络安全编程、自动化运维编程以及数据分析与算法编程等多种编程技术。这些技术的掌握将有助于他们在网络技术领域取得卓越的成就。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    NOC大赛(网络操作中心挑战赛)是一个面向大学生的网络技术竞赛,要求参赛选手具备扎实的计算机网络知识和编程能力。在NOC大赛中,淄博地区的主要编程内容包括以下几个方面:

    1. 网络编程:参赛选手需要具备使用编程语言(如C、Java、Python等)进行网络通信的能力,包括socket编程、网络协议实现、网络数据包的传输和处理等。常见的任务包括实现一个基于TCP或UDP的网络应用、解析和构造网络数据包等。

    2. 安全编程:网络安全是NOC大赛的重要内容之一。选手需要了解常见的网络安全攻击手段和防御策略,并能够根据给定的场景设计和实现相应的安全算法或网络安全解决方案。

    3. 数据库编程:参赛选手需要具备与数据库进行交互的能力,包括编写SQL语句、设计数据库模式、进行数据库查询和数据操作等。常见的任务包括实现一个简单的数据库管理系统、进行数据库性能优化等。

    4. 算法与数据结构:NOC大赛要求选手能够熟练运用常见的算法和数据结构,包括排序、查找、图论算法等。选手需要能够分析和解决复杂的算法问题,并能够根据实际需求设计和实现高效的算法。

    5. 分布式系统编程:随着云计算和大数据时代的到来,分布式系统的编程能力变得越来越重要。在NOC大赛中,选手需要具备分布式系统编程的能力,包括分布式文件系统、分布式计算框架、分布式数据库等。

    参赛选手在NOC大赛中将会面对各种真实的网络问题和技术挑战,需要进行快速的解决和创新。通过参加NOC大赛,不仅可以提高编程技能,还可以增强团队合作能力和解决问题的能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    NOI(全国青少年信息学奥林匹克竞赛)是中国高中生之间最具影响力和最高水平的计算机竞赛,它是ICPC国内选拔赛和ACM-ICPC世界总决赛的正式选拔赛。作为NOI的分站赛之一,NOC(National Olympiad in Informatics in China)国家信息学奥林匹克竞赛是中国最重要的程序设计竞赛之一。在NOC比赛中,学生将通过解决算法和数据结构问题来展示他们的编程能力。

    在NOC比赛中,编程语言可以选择C、C++和Pascal,但是C++是最常用的语言。NOC的比赛内容主要包括以下几个方面:

    1. 算法与数据结构:参赛选手需要对常见的算法和数据结构有深入的理解和掌握,比如排序算法、搜索算法、图论算法、动态规划等。他们需要使用这些算法和数据结构来解决给定的问题。

    2. 模拟和优化问题:选手需要面对一些实际问题,通过模拟和优化的方法来解决。这些问题可能涉及到计算机程序的性能优化、模拟实验等。

    3. 图论问题:图论是NOC比赛中的一个重要的考点。选手需要熟练掌握图的基本概念和算法,如最短路径算法、最小生成树算法等。

    4. 动态规划问题:动态规划是解决一些复杂问题的重要方法。在NOC比赛中,选手通常会遇到一些需要使用动态规划思想来解决的问题。

    5. 字符串处理问题:选手需要熟练掌握字符串的基本操作和算法,如字符串匹配算法、编辑距离算法等。

    参赛选手需要在规定的时间内编写和调试程序来解决给定的问题。他们需要充分利用编程语言的特性和编程技巧来完成任务,并保证程序的正确性和效率。比赛结束后,选手的程序将会由评委进行评测,根据程序的正确性和效率给出相应的得分。

    总结来说,NOC比赛主要考察选手的算法和数据结构的基本知识,以及编程能力和解决实际问题的能力。选手需要通过深入学习和练习,不断提升自己的编程水平和解决问题的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部